GNOME Online Accounts provides interfaces so that applications and
libraries in GNOME can access the user's online accounts. It has
providers for Google, ownCloud, Facebook, Flickr, Windows Live,
Microsoft Exchange and Kerberos.
Overview of changes in 3.7.91
=============================
* IMAP/SMTP is enabled by default
* Bugs fixed:
660882 Drop the notification from EnsureCredentials
695065 build: Tell git.mk to ignore generated files
695074 build: Fix `make distcheck` by updating the icon cache on uninstall too
695106 Do not send the credentials before notifying the user of an invalid
SSL certificate (CVE-2013-1799)
